The Swim Prize.
The Prize should we be successful in June is Massive..! Pip,s would join a very exclusive club of just handful of teams that have successfully completed the a double English channel Swim (Since records began 1950 ), only 55 teams from around the world  have ever achieved a 2 way crossing ..of which  only 14 teams were from the UK...only 14.!!! 
Successful  2 way channel Men's / Ladies relay swims by year since  records were started in 1950..( Relay Records  from  http://www.channelswimming.net/index.htm )
1971...United Nations                                        International             24HRS 07Mins
1973... Eastern Marathon S.Assoc.                    USA                        29 46
1974...Hetzel's Texas Volunteers                        USA                        17 50.
1974...Eastern Marathon SC                              USA                        31 26
1977...Egyptian Relay                                        Egypt                       17 34
1977...Saudi Arabian Relay                              Saudi Arabia             16 05
1980...7th Regiment RHA                                 U.K                         19 40
1981...7th Reg. Royal Horse Artillery                U.K                         24 09
1981...Belgian Channel (Breaststroke)              Belgium                    24 01
1982...Br. Cross Channel (Disabled)                 U.K                         24 14
1985...West 1 International                               U.K                          15 36
1986...Egyptian Sports Fed(Disabled)               Egypt                       25 11
1987...Scarborough Castle LDSC                    U.K                          26 43
1988...Eltham Training & S.C.                          U.K                          30 06
1990...US National Swim Team                        USA                         14 18(WORLD RECORD)
1990...Bolton Metro                                         U.K                         28 39
1991...Howe Bridge (Breast Stroke)                 U.K                         29 15
1992...Canadian Channel Challenge                  Canada                    18 48
1993..RAF                                                       U.K                         20 51
1993 Wielkopolanka                                        Poland                      20 43
1994...Sazanami                                              Japan                         24 14
1996...West Aussie Double Crossers               Australia                    19 26
1996...National Grid Ladies                             U.K                           25 01 
1997...Exmouth Swimming & L.S.S.                U.K                           23 41 
1998...Pine Crest Juniors                                 USA/Venezuela          19 25
1998...Pine Crest Seniors                                USA/Venezuela          16 48
1998 ..Sakura                                                 Japan                          24 36
1999..Adventure Seeker                                 International                19 25
2001...Team Extreme                                     Australia                     20 59
2001...Mexican American Family                   Mexico/USA              18 48
2003...Force 6 America                                 USA                          20 18
2003...Michigan Masochists                           USA                          21 20
2004.. Irish Team C                                       Ireland                       27 48
2004....Victoria Police                                   Australia                     24 45                                                     
2005... Femmes de la Manche                       International                30 40
2005...Fionn Uisce                                        Ireland                        30 23
2005.. Finn McCool                                      Ireland                        31 56
2005...Lir                                                      Ireland                        33  05
2005...First Mexican Relay                            Mexico                       20 14
2005...Eltham Training & SC (1)                     UK                           31 36
2006....Casablanca Mexico                           Mexico                       18 54
2006... ABCDEFGH                                    USA                           21 37                                                                          
2007...New York Harbor Seals                    USA                           21 45 
2007...Altamar 66K                                     Mexico                       18  59                                                      
2007...Warrington Dolphins                            UK                          28 54
2008...Friends All Swimming Together (2)    Australia                      25 51
2008...Friends All Swimming Together (1)    Australia                      26 06 
2008...Casablanca Mexico                           Mexico                        31 56 
2008...Dublin Fire Brigade                           Ireland                         21 12
2012 Warwick School                                  UK                             25 37
2012 Channel for ALS                                   ?                                18.55
2012 Silver Marlins                                        ?                                 24.04
2012 Dutch Ladies                                       Holland                        18.21 (WR all ladies team)
2012 2 by 3                                                    ?                                30.16
2013 Big Ricks & Pip,s Swim Team                          UK                             ?????

In 2012 Big Ricks Swim Team got within half a mile of completing a double swim of the English channel, but due to extreme weather fog,rain,8 ft waves ,force 5 winds, strong sea swells (just a normal day in the channel really) , the swim was eventually stopped , our pilot Mr Freddy Mardle had let us swim on for 4 hrs through the bad weather hoping against hope it would clear enough for us to be able to finish  but sadly the weather to get even worse as we approached Dover as darkness fell , so after swimming for more than 22 hours Fred had to stop the swim due to his growing concerns for not only for the safety of the swimmer in Water , but also for the safety of the 9 soles on board the Masterpiece boat , it was the correct decision off course ,  we loved Fred words after we finally arrived back in folkestone harbour  at 2 am some 26 hours after we left.. ..Well Lads you did okay , you almost made it, i know you are down and disappointed now , but Ha that's channel swimming for you...Everyday is different , Everyday brings a new challenge , if it was easy everyone would be doing it..!!,  just be glad your safe and well and able to try again.!! .. every channel swimmer knows Captain Webb`s famous remarks about swimming the Channel...."" Nothing Great Is Easy,"" he can say that again..
